What do literary agents look for in poetry and fiction submissions?In poetry, literary agents often look for a unique voice. They want to see fresh perspectives and innovative use of language. For example, a poet who can play with rhythm in an unexpected way might catch their attention. In fiction, they look for a strong plot. A plot that hooks the reader from the start and keeps them engaged throughout is highly desirable.

What do literary agencies look for in horror fiction submissions?Literary agencies are interested in the marketability of horror fiction submissions. If they think the story has the potential to attract a large audience, they are more likely to consider it. This includes elements like having a relatable protagonist in a terrifying situation. They also look at the overall atmosphere created in the story. A really spooky and immersive atmosphere can be a big plus.

What are the criteria for publishers of short horror stories to accept submissions?Typically, publishers look for originality. A unique take on horror that stands out from the common tropes. For example, a new spin on the haunted house concept. They also consider the writing quality. Good grammar, engaging prose, and a strong narrative voice are important. Like, if the story can hook the reader from the start.

Call for Submissions: Horror Short Story - How to Start Writing One?Begin with a mood. Maybe a feeling of isolation or dread. You can describe the weather, like a howling wind or a heavy, oppressive fog. Then introduce your character, perhaps someone who is already in a vulnerable state. They could be lost in a strange place or dealing with a personal crisis. From there, start to introduce the elements of horror, like a strange figure in the distance or a voice that seems to come from nowhere.
Call for Submissions: Horror Short Story - What are the Key Elements to Include?Typical key elements in a horror short story are a spooky setting, like an old, creaky mansion or a fog - covered forest. Also, an eerie atmosphere created through descriptions of dim lighting and strange sounds. A menacing antagonist, whether it's a supernatural being like a vampire or a deranged human, is crucial. And of course, a sense of impending doom for the protagonist that keeps the reader on edge.

Open submissions horror novels: How can I find inspiration for writing one?Inspiration can come from various sources. One way is to watch horror movies or read other horror novels. Notice the elements that made them effective or scary. Another source could be historical events. For instance, the Salem witch trials can inspire a horror novel set in that time period, exploring the paranoia and superstition. You can also use your own nightmares as inspiration. Try to remember the details and feelings from those dreams and turn them into a horror story.
